Gas Hobs
A good hob is essential in modern kitchens. If you're looking for gas, induction or ceramic there's a model to suit your style and budget. A good hob will cook quickly and evenly, allowing you to cook food in a matter of minutes. It also adds an elegant look to your kitchen.
The precise temperature control is among its key benefits. It's easy to reach high temperatures, which is ideal for boiling water, searing meat or stir-frying vegetables. The ability to adjust the heat output quickly is useful for delicate dishes and sauces that require a lower heat setting.
Another benefit of a gas stove is its energy efficiency. It uses natural gas, which is usually cheaper than electricity, which makes it more affordable to operate a hob. It also makes use of a direct flame for heating your utensils. This means that there is less energy wasted around burner edges.
Modern gas hobs come with a sleek design to match any kitchen design. You can find models with a shiny black or stainless steel finish that will blend seamlessly into the decor and make your kitchen look more contemporary. You can also pick a glass model that is easy to clean and highly durable.

Induction Hobs
While gas ovens hobs are still a popular choice for home cooks Induction cookers are gaining popularity for their speed and efficiency. These glass-topped flat stoves use magnetism instead of heat to heat the pan's contents. This makes them more efficient and safer because there isn't any flame underneath. Induction hobs come with a range of features. Our Good Housekeeping Institute experts found that some of these features can be extremely beneficial.
One of them is a bridge function that lets you connect two hob rings to accommodate larger pans. You can also choose to manage the temperature of each ring separately through the touchscreen panel. This is a great option for those who enjoy entertaining and could be a lifesaver in the event that you have guests with different food preferences. Induction hobs are dangerous for people with pacemakers because they generate electromagnetic fields that can disrupt the operation of their devices.
The British Heart Foundation recommends that you maintain a distance of at 60cm between any power source and a hob that is active, in the event that you wear a pacemaker. The magnetic field created by the hob may interact with electrical devices and cause them to malfunction, so you should ensure that the device isn't in the vicinity of a hot plate or near an area of cooking live.

The word hob is an ancient English term that originally meant the term 'a grate or shelf that is placed by a flame'. It's an old-fashioned term that describes how we cooked at home in previous decades with large fireplaces and shelves that were separate for pots. Nowadays, kitchens are equipped with an oven, as well as an additional hob (stove top) which is either gas or electric.
Some countries refer to the stove as a cooker, culinary however the British call it a hob. Hobs are a separate appliance that uses heating rings that heat saucepans as well as a cooker, which is a bigger freestanding unit that includes oven and hob.
